JUSTICE HEMANT KUMAR SRIVASTAVA ORAL ORDER 02/ 16.03.2016 Supplementary affidavit is filed on behalf of the petitioner without welfare stamp and it is informed that welfare stamp is not available.
Heard learned counsel for the petitioner, learned Addl. Public Prosecutor for the State as well as learned counsel for the informant.
Petitioner seeks bail in a case registered under section 307 and other allied sections of the Indian Penal Code as well as section 27 of the Arms Act.
Petitioner is named in the first information report but general allegation of firing has been levelled against the petitioner and other accused. Moreover, informant has, himself, admitted in his written report that only abrasion was caused due to firing made by FIR named accused.
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.11460 of 2016 (2) dt.16-03-2016 Moreover, injury report of the informant shows that one lacerated wound was found on his neck and no abnormality detected in course of medical examination.
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ances as well as submissions of the parties, let the petitioner be released on bail on furnishing bail bonds of Rs 10,000/- with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of Smt.
